I was about to give up on these goodies arriving but at work this afternoon a couple of brown paper packages tied with hairy string were plonked on my desk
... A 35mm viewfinder for the J12 I got a couple of months ago and a Zorki 5 kit. The Z5 kit was a bit of a gamble, I was looking for a black J8 for a project camera I'm working on and this kit came up for about $10 more than I was going to pay for a nice lens. No one else bid so it was mine, looking over it I think I got a nice little bargain, the J8 is spotless and very smooth and best of all the markings are engraved not painted on like all the other black J8's I've seen.. I couldn't see that from the auction pics. I also ended up with a clean yellow filter with case, hood (my first!), lens cap, very clean “never ready” case, reloadable canister and cable release. The body feels like its had a CLA recently and maybe new curtains .... too cool! .. Now I just need to find a few cookies to go with my coffee.
